Urban Politics

CUNY Queens College

CoursePSCI 211

An examination of city politics, past and present, with an emphasis on the interaction between politics and the economy. Topics include political machines and the Reform Movement in the 19th Century; suburbanization and urban decline in the 20th Century; and immigration, globalization, and urban neo-liberalism in the contemporary era. Issues of class and race/ethnicity run throughout the course. Attention is given to particular cities such as New York, Chicago, Los Angeles, and Detroit.
